Ah, my dear seeker of truth, as you journey through the sacred scriptures, you will encounter profound mysteries and divine revelations. In the Gospel of John, it is beautifully written: "In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God" (John 1:1, NIV). This passage reveals the eternal nature of Jesus, the Word made flesh, who dwelt among us full of grace and truth. As you continue to ponder upon this, consider also the words of Jesus Himself, who declared, "I and the Father are one" (John 10:30, NIV). This profound unity with the Father signifies His divine essence. Furthermore, in the Gospel of John, Jesus prays, "Father, glorify me in your presence with the glory I had with you before the world began" (John 17:5, NIV), affirming His pre-existence and divine glory. Embrace the mystery with awe and reverence, for in Jesus, the fullness of God dwells in bodily form (Colossians 2:9, NIV). Bible Commentary

John 1:1
In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God.

John 1:1 states, "In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God." This verse introduces the concept of the Word, or "Logos," as eternal and divine. The "Word" signifies Jesus Christ, emphasizing His pre-existence and unity with God. It asserts His divine nature, setting the foundation for understanding the Trinity. This verse highlights the profound mystery of Jesus as both distinct from and one with God, underscoring His role in creation and revelation.
